Quick Rod Progression Overview
| Stage | Rod | Cost | Key Stats | Best Location |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Early Game | Lava Rod | Free | 30% Luck, 2% Speed, 100kg | Kohana Volcano |
| Early-Mid | Lucky Rod | $15,000 | 130% Luck, 7% Speed, 5,000kg | Rod Shop |
| Mid Game | Chrome Rod | $437,000 | 229% Luck, 23% Speed, 190,000kg | Rod Shop |
| Mid-Late | Hazmat Rod | $1,300,000 | 380% Luck, 32% Speed, 300,000kg | Traveling Merchant |
| Late Game | Ghostfinn Rod | Quest | 610% Luck, 118% Speed, 600,000kg | Lost Isle Quest |
| Endgame | Element Rod | Quest | 1111% Luck, 130% Speed, 900,000kg | Sacred Temple Quest |
Early Game: Foundation Building
Starter Rod → Lava Rod
Your journey begins with the basic Starter Rod, but you’ll want to replace it immediately. The Lava Rod is your first major upgrade and it’s completely free!
How to Get Lava Rod:
- Travel to Kohana Volcano (costs minimal coins)
- Find the Lava Fisherman NPC
- Simply talk to him and he’ll give you the Lava Rod
Why Lava Rod is Essential:
- 30% Luck boost immediately increases rare fish chances
- 100kg weight capacity lets you catch bigger fish
- Free upgrade saves coins for future investments
- Perfect for grinding in Kohana Volcano
Pro Tip: Stay in Kohana Volcano with your Lava Rod until you have at least $20,000. The volcanic fish sell well and you’ll build capital faster than in starting areas.
Lucky Rod: Your First Major Investment
Once you’ve saved up $15,000, the Lucky Rod becomes your next target. This rod is a game-changer for early progression.
Lucky Rod Stats Breakdown:
- Luck: 130% (massive jump from 30%)
- Speed: 7% (slightly faster reeling)
- Weight: 5,000kg (huge capacity increase)
Why It’s Worth Every Coin: The 130% Luck bonus dramatically increases your chances of catching Rare and Epic fish. These sell for significantly more, accelerating your path to mid-game rods.
Best Farming Strategy: Use Lucky Rod with Midnight Bait in Esoteric Depths. The combination of high luck and appropriate bait creates a perfect money-making loop that will fund your next upgrades quickly.
Mid Game: Scaling Your Success
Chrome Rod: The Epic Powerhouse
At $437,000, the Chrome Rod represents your first major investment, but it’s absolutely worth it.
Chrome Rod Advantages:
- 229% Luck – Consistent Rare/Epic catches
- 23% Speed – Noticeably faster fishing
- 190,000kg Weight – Handle massive fish without line breaks
Money Making Strategy: Pair Chrome Rod with Chroma Bait in the Esoteric Depths. You’ll start seeing regular Mythic fish that sell for 50,000-100,000 coins each. This is where your income really starts to explode.
Common Mistake to Avoid: Don’t skip Chrome Rod for Steampunk Rod just because it’s cheaper. Chrome’s superior stats make it more profitable in the long run.
Hazmat Rod: The Traveling Merchant Gem
The Hazmat Rod is where things get interesting. At $1,300,000, it’s expensive, but its stats make it one of the best pre-endgame rods available.
Hazmat Rod Excellence:
- 380% Luck – Mythic fish become common
- 32% Speed – Fast reeling for efficient grinding
- 300,000kg Weight – Handle any fish except the absolute largest
How to Get Hazmat Rod:
- Watch for the Traveling Merchant (spawns randomly)
- Check merchant inventory multiple times daily
- Buy immediately when available – it’s rare!
Pro Strategy: Use Hazmat Rod with Corrupt Bait in Volcano or Esoteric Depths. The mutation chance from Corrupt Bait combined with Hazmat’s luck creates incredible profit potential.
Late Game: Chasing Excellence
Ghostfinn Rod: The Quest Reward
The Ghostfinn Rod represents your transition from purchased rods to quest-based progression. This rod cannot be bought – it must be earned through dedication.
Ghostfinn Quest Requirements:
- Catch 300 Rare or Epic fish in Treasure Room (Lost Isle)
- Catch 3 Mythic fish at Sisyphus Statue
- Catch 1 Secret fish anywhere on Lost Isle
- Earn 1,000,000 total coins
Ghostfinn Rod Stats:
- 610% Luck – Secret fish become achievable
- 118% Speed – Lightning-fast reeling
- 600,000kg Weight – Handle virtually any fish
Quest Strategy:
- Use Hazmat Rod for the Treasure Room grinding
- Save your best bait for the Mythic requirements
- The Secret fish requirement is the hardest – consider using luck potions
Why Ghostfinn is Worth the Grind: This rod is the second-best in the entire game and makes catching Secret fish actually feasible. The income potential is insane.
Element Rod: The Ultimate Prize
The Element Rod is currently the best rod in Fish It and represents the true endgame. Only the most dedicated players reach this point.
Element Rod Quest Requirements:
- Must own Ghostfinn Rod first
- Catch 1 Secret fish in Ancient Jungle
- Catch 1 Secret fish in Sacred Temple
- Create 3 Transcendent Stones (sacrifice 3 Secret fish)
Element Rod God-Tier Stats:
- 1111% Luck – Secret fish become common
- 130% Speed – Maximum reeling speed
- 900,000kg Weight – No fish is too heavy
Preparation Tips:
- Complete Ghostfinn quest first
- Stockpile Singularity Bait (8.2M coins from merchant)
- Join a active Discord for Secret fish location sharing
Advanced Rod Strategies
Enchantment Combinations
Maximize your rod potential with the right enchantments:
Early-Mid Game:
- Empowered + Leprechaun II (focus on coin income)
Late-Endgame:
- Empowered + Mutation Hunter II + Gold Digger (maximum profit)
Bait Progression
Your bait should progress alongside your rods:
- Basic/Midnight Bait (Early game)
- Chroma Bait (Mid game with Chrome Rod)
- Corrupt Bait (Late game with Hazmat Rod)
- Aether Bait (Endgame prep)
- Singularity Bait (Element Rod optimization)

Recent Updates Impacting Rod Progression
The Ancient Jungle Update June 2026 introduced significant changes:
- 27 new fish added to the game
- New OP rods available through the Battlepass
- F2P Battlepass at new island provides rod alternatives
- Lower tier SECRET fish added to Sisyphus Statue
- Buffed Luck Totem affects all rod effectiveness
These changes have made progression slightly easier for new players while maintaining the endgame challenge.

Frequently Asked Questions
When should I upgrade my rod in Fish It?
Upgrade when you consistently catch fish that max out your current rod’s weight capacity or when you have enough coins to purchase the next tier while maintaining operating capital.
Should I enchant my rods in Fish It?
Absolutely! Enchantments can double your rod’s effectiveness. Focus on Empowered for early game, then add Mutation Hunter II and Gold Digger for late game profit maximization.
What’s the fastest way to get the Element Rod?
Follow the progression path exactly: Lava → Lucky → Chrome → Hazmat → Ghostfinn → Element. Don’t skip steps and always use appropriate bait for each rod tier.
Is the Hazmat Rod worth 1.3 million coins?
Yes, it’s one of the best investments in the game. The 380% luck boost dramatically increases your income potential and makes the Ghostfinn quest much easier.
Can I get good rods without spending real money?
Absolutely! All progression rods are obtainable through gameplay. The only paid items are cosmetic skins and some convenience items.
What bait should I use with each rod?
- Lava/Lucky Rod: Midnight Bait
- Chrome Rod: Chroma Bait
- Hazmat Rod: Corrupt Bait
- Ghostfinn Rod: Mutation/Aether Bait
- Element Rod: Singularity Bait
How do I find the Traveling Merchant?
The merchant spawns randomly every few hours. Join the official Discord for merchant alerts, or check major islands every 30-60 minutes.
What’s the best money-making strategy?
Use Chrome Rod with Chroma Bait in Esoteric Depths until you can afford Hazmat Rod, then switch to Hazmat with Corrupt Bait for maximum profit.
